Role Overview
- L3 Cybersecurity Operations Coordinator acting as a CSIRT/SOC relay between local business teams and global CDOC
- Ensures rapid incident response, escalation management, and stakeholder coordination
- Bridges business, functional, and technical cybersecurity operations
Key Responsibilities
Cybersecurity Operations & Coordination
- Act as primary cybersecurity contact for local sites
- Coordinate with global SOC/CDOC teams for operational alignment
- Ensure proximity-based support for critical assets and business priorities
Incident Response & Escalation Management
- Handle L3 incident escalation and complex case coordination
- Lead incident triage, mitigation tracking, and remediation follow-up
- Support end-to-end incident lifecycle (detection → containment → recovery)
Advanced Incident Handling (L3 Support)
- Manage critical and non-standard cybersecurity incidents
- Lead containment, threat eradication, and system restoration
- Validate secure remediation and recovery actions
Crisis & Major Incident Management
- Support CSIRT-led crisis management during major cyber incidents
- Coordinate cross-functional response during high-impact events
Stakeholder Management & Communication
- Act as bridge between technical teams and business stakeholders
- Ensure bi-directional communication (site ↔ SOC/CDOC)
- Provide status updates, impact analysis, and action visibility
Requirements Translation & Solution Alignment
- Translate business/security requirements into technical controls
- Support global cybersecurity solution alignment with local constraints
Continuous Improvement & Process Optimization
- Drive SOC/CDOC process improvements and operational efficiency
- Promote best practices, knowledge sharing, and service enhancement
